Psalm 51:10 ... Create in me a clean heart, O God; and renew a right spirit within me.

"Give me a clean heart, O Lord."  Well, He did ... now it's up to me to keep it clean.

My prayer in the morning when I wake up is: "I thank You, Father, that by the Blood of Jesus I am cleansed.  Sin has no more place in my life.  I am healed!  Jesus, thank You that You brought God's Divine Nature to me."

His Divine Nature is in us ... His attributes ... the Fruit of the Spirit.  Because of His Divine Nature I have Divine healing going on in my body all the time.  Because I have Divine healing I walk in Divine health ... one to the other.  Now if I shortcut this somewhere, who pays the price?  I DO!  This isn't pleasing to God because He paid the price for me.  The "old me" is dead. 

When we are disobedient to God, we're really being disobedient to His possession.  We are His possession. Some Christians are living to (for) themselves ... they don't realize that God owns them.  He isn't a dominating God Who's going to say legalistically: "Do this and this and this" or "Don't do this and this and this."

Deuteronomy 30:19 ... "I have set before you life and death, blessing and cursing: therefore choose life that both you and your seed may live."

This says ... "both you and your seed".  So your obedience and disobedience involves not only yourself, but also your offspring, your children, grandchildren, etc., on down the line.  So think about what you do that the consequences would involve your family for ages to come.  You want obedience!

Here God says that all these things ... "You can choose life or you can choose death ... now choose LIFE."  You get to choose ... He doesn't choose for you.
